OrderingListTestCase in
richfaces-demo functional test in JSF2:

http://hudson.qa.jboss.com/hudson/view/Richfaces-Release/job/richfaces-3.3-release-jsf2-demoapp-ftest-firefox-linux/

builds #29 to #32.

In console output, you can see:

[INFO] [talledLocalContainer] 02:26:58,136 ERROR [[Faces Servlet]]
Servlet.service() for servlet Faces Servlet threw exception
[INFO] [talledLocalContainer]
javax.faces.application.ViewExpiredException:
viewId:/richfaces/orderingList.jsf - View /richfaces/orderingList.jsf
could not be restored.


Run the OrderingListTestCase over this configuration.

The selenium is browsing through pages so quickly that it violates this exception.
